POWER-CON / THUNDERCON BENEFIT AUCTION
Comic book and toy artists unite to support Power-Con / ThunderCon and the CAAF
September 12, 2011 – Power-Con / ThunderCon will be working with The Big Toy Auction to host an auction during the show’s after-hours fan and talent mixer on Saturday, September 24, 2011. Half of all proceeds will be donated to the Children Affected By AIDS Foundation.
The after-hours fan and talent mixer is open to the general public. Bids can be placed by registered in-house participants at the auction beginning at 10:00pm PST in the Woods Rooms at the Four Points by Sheraton LAX. There will be a number of floor-bidding-only items, so we invite everyone to come out for a night of fun!
